What is the meaning of computer vision?
Computer vision is a part of AI that allows computers to look at and analyse pictures and videos in ways that are similar to how people do it. Computer vision systems may find similar behaviours, identify objects, and even make decisions based on visual data by using machine learning and deep learning models.
Computer vision systems “learn” from big datasets, which makes them more suitable over time. This is different from traditional programming, where you give them clear instructions. This skill lets companies in all fields automate difficult tasks, boost efficiency, and find new business prospects.
Uses of Computer Vision in Healthcare
Healthcare is one of the best places for computer vision to be used. The capability to analyze medical images, solving problems, and help with diagnoses is totally different now the way patients are cared for.
Computer vision can look for diseases like cancer, pneumonia, or retinal abnormalities before time and more precisely than other methods. AI-driven imaging tools help radiologists make fewer mistakes when diagnosing patients.
Real time image recognition is used by smart surgical systems to help surgeons perform minimally invasive surgeries. Vision-based systems for remote patient monitoring keep an eye on patients’ activities, like spotting falls in older people or looking at rehabilitation exercises.
Drug Research: Computer vision makes it easier to look at molecular structures and find prospective drug possibilities.

Worker Safety:
Computer vision makes the production floor safer by spotting harmful actions or dangerous situations. Some examples are noticing when a worker goes into a prohibited area, doesn’t wear protective gear, or is about to hit a piece of machinery. Real-time alerts can be set up to stop mishaps.

Computer Vision’s Problems and Future
There are many chances for computer vision to grow, but there are also problems including privacy concerns, algorithm bias, and high costs of implementation. Businesses and authorities both still believe that having to be sure that visual data is being used ethically is important.
For later practices, combining computer vision with other new technologies the Internet of Things (IoT) will make it even more effective. For example, self-driving cars that can “see” and “understand” could change the way we build cities, manage disasters, and run logistics.
